Aerinite named after the light blue crystal ![]() Witch Doctor The clan’s first herbalist and witch doctor. Started growing helpful herbs and fungi since the clan was first founded, long before they had their own farms. Many younger dragons look up to her and try to emulate her, mixing their natural magic with whatever “herbs” they may find. Oftentimes they’re nothing more than twigs, burnt by their lightning, but Aerinite appreciates their attempts nonetheless. Over the years, she’s amassed a collection of gifts crafted personally for her by the hatchlings she’s inspired. She’s rather social for a Bogsneak, most often with younger dragons and hatchlings; Aerinite believes it’s best for a dragon to learn basic herbalism at a young age. Each hatchling that leaves her den always carries out a Forest Field Guide and a small satchel. Aerinite has tasked these youngsters with locating, identifying, and collecting each item in the guide, preparing their minds for surviving off of the fruits of the land. You never know when you’ll be stuck on your own, with only the wilderness to forage from. Aerinite’s Toridae companion Tori is especially friendly with children. Aerinite raised Tori from a sprout, so she’s always been acclimated to dragons. Tori’s venom can be easily extracted from her tail, and Aerinite has used it for many types of antidotes; even for toxins produced by other means. Because of this, she’s more likely to be approached by dragons needing antidotes than Antix, who dragons often see for other means of healing.
